  498. <h3>Legal Compliance</h3>
  499. <p> Legal compliance is a cornerstone of real estate training in Queensland (QLD), Australia. It ensures that real estate professionals possess a thorough understanding of the legal framework governing the industry, enabling them to operate ethically and protect the interests of their clients. </p>
  500. <ul>
  501. <li><strong>Real Estate Institute of Queensland (REIQ) Code of Conduct:</strong> This code outlines the ethical and professional standards that real estate agents must adhere to, including obligations related to disclosure, confidentiality, and handling of trust accounts. </li>
  502. <li><strong>Property Law Act 1974 (QLD):</strong> This legislation governs property transactions in QLD, including the sale, purchase, and leasing of real estate. Real estate professionals must be familiar with the provisions of this Act to ensure compliance and protect their clients&rsquo; legal rights. </li>
  503. <li><strong>Body Corporate and Community Management Act 1997 (QLD):</strong> This Act regulates the operation of body corporates, which are responsible for the management of common areas and facilities in residential and commercial developments. Real estate professionals involved in the sale or management of properties within these developments must be aware of the relevant provisions of this Act. </li>
  504. <li><strong>Anti-Money Laundering and Counter-Terrorism Financing Act 2006 (Cth):</strong> This Act imposes obligations on real estate professionals to identify and report suspicious transactions that may be related to money laundering or terrorism financing. </li>
  505. </ul>
  506. <p> Understanding and adhering to these laws and regulations is essential for real estate professionals to operate legally and ethically. Real estate training in QLD places a strong emphasis on legal compliance, equipping agents with the knowledge and skills to navigate the complex legal landscape of the industry. </p>
